The way I found out that I needed to do the recall fix was by going to the Ford web site and clicking on the safety recall link under ownership on the bottom of the page. My wife called the next day to the local dealership and they said to get it in by 11. There was no charge and they changed the sensor that goes into the master cylinder and added a short wiring harness the has a fusable link in it. The original system had no fuse to pop to cut power if (more like when) the switch shorted from the brake fluid leaking all over it.
